The 2010 One D Scorecard measures Southeast Michigan’s performance in over 120 indicators aligned with five key priority areas: Educational Preparedness, Economic Prosperity, Quality of Life, Social Equity, and Regional Transit. Governor Snyder discussed transportation in his State of the State address. He explained that the Department of Transportation will be part of his Economic Development team, demonstrating how highly he values transportation.
